WWE veteran Brian "Road Dogg" James worked with the WWE for over three decades as a superstar and as a backstage producer.

The star worked under Vince McMahon for the majority of his career and is currently working under his friend Triple H.

The former D Generation X member revealed that Vince McMahon didn't have a clue about some of his superstars as he didn't watch their matches in NXT.

One major star that Vince McMahon didn't know was Gunther (formerly known as Walter). The Ring General was on Smackdown in 2019 while the rest of the roster was stuck in Saudi Arabia.

WWE did an invasion angle with NXT stars invading Smackdown to take out the main roster stars to build up the Survivor Series 2019.

On the "Oh…. You Didn't Know" podcast, Road Dogg said that Vince McMahon didn't have a clue on what Gunther brought to the table.

Gunther was called up to the main roster after two years. Vince McMahon later reportedly lost interest in the superstar after a segment with R-Truth on Raw.

Gunther is currently the Intercontinental champion on Smackdown and is one of the top stars on the blue brand. He's unbeaten in singles competition since making his Smackdown debut.
